Robbinsdale Chiropractor Dr. Justin Elder

Dr. Justin Elder's chiropractic story started in college. As a track and field athlete at South Dakota State University his body got banged around a lot. The athletic training department at the college did a good job at keeping the athlete's bodies healthy, but it wasn't until he started seeing a chiropractor that he really understood the importance and potential outcomes of proper spinal alignment and biomechanics. Chiropractic was an integral part of many accomplishments Dr. Justin achieved, including 2 school records and All-American status in college track and field. Now as a practicing chiropractor Dr. Justin clearly sees the nearly endless benefits that chiropractic provides for people of all ages; infants, children, teens, and adults.

Dr. Justin received his undergraduate degree from South Dakota State University in Biology and Chemistry and then attended Northwestern College of Chiropractic here in Bloomington, MN where he graduated with honors. Fresh out of chiropractic school in 2003 Dr. Justin joined the team at Robbinsdale ChiroCenter and has had the pleasure of practicing here ever since.

Dr. Justin is currently enrolled in a one year long Wellness Certification Program offered by the International Chiropractic Association. The Wellness Certification Program provides the most up-to-date health and wellness information focusing on the three pillars of well-being; Movement, Nutrition, and Attitude.

Dr. Justin's free time is spent enjoying the outdoors, usually with his wife Traci. Fly fishing is at the top of the list for favorite activities closely followed by the ever-maddening game of golf. Many summer evenings you can find Justin splashing around the trout streams of western Wisconsin.
